#b24a05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b24a05 is composed of 69.8% red, 29%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 23.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 35.9%. #b24a05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ff940a with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#b24a05 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#b24a05 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b24a05 has RGB values of R:178, G:74,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.97,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11684357.

Shades and Tints of #b24a05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060300 is the darkest color, while #fff7f2 is the lightest one.
